Adults With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D)

If you're an adult who suffers from att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) the diagnosis is the first step in getting treatment and reducing your symptoms. It can be a challenge to know where to start.

A thorough ADHD evaluation begins with an extensive interview. It involves reviewing your childhood and up to the present. This could include asking about your driving habits, your social, and personal habits.

Diagnosis

It's crucial to speak to a mental health professional if you suspect you might be suffering from ADHD. They can provide a formal diagnosis and recommend treatment options. They also offer assistance and can help you locate sources of help.

A diagnosis of ADHD is made following an exhaustive clinical interview by analyzing data from a variety of sources. These include standardized behavior rating scales, symptom checklists, a thorough account of past and current symptoms and interviews with family members or others who know the patient well, and tests of cognitive abilities and academic performance.

The most accurate method to diagnose adult ADHD is to conduct a thorough clinical examination, performed by a specialist in this condition who takes the time to gather data and evaluate the patient's condition. The process could take several sessions, usually over several months.

A doctor will examine you as well as anyone who is familiar with you for example, your spouse or parent, or even a teacher, coach or nanny for children. This information is used to assist the doctor in determining whether additional conditions could be causing your symptoms.

During the interview, she'll ask you about any changes in your behavior in the last 6 months that are related to your symptoms. She will also ask about your relationships with other people, including coworkers and friends. She may also inquire about any other conditions or illnesses which are known to affect the behavior of people with ADHD.

When she's satisfied that you have a pattern of at least five symptoms for both the inattention and hyperactive-impulsive presentations, she will make a formal diagnosis. This diagnosis will allow her to determine the type of therapy and strategies for coping that are the most effective for you.

To screen for other conditions that may be affecting your behavior, your doctor could require additional tests like tests for psychiatric disorders and broad-spectrum scales. These tests are used to rule out other disorders that can cause the same kind of issues as ADHD for example, mood or anxiety disorders.

Support

If you suspect you suffer from ADHD There are a variety of resources available to help you to determine the diagnosis. These include self-assessment instruments such as the World Health Organization* adult ADHD test, as well as mental health professionals.

A diagnostic test conducted by a trained mental health professional is the most effective way to receive an accurate diagnosis of ADHD. A doctor will first inquire about the symptoms you experience and any problems they've caused in your life. The doctor might also speak with someone who knows you well like siblings or spouses to see if they could give additional information.

The doctor may also give you tests to determine if you have the signs and symptoms of ADHD. These may include checklists of symptoms as well as tests for attention span.

If you're diagnosed with ADHD by your doctor the treatment will be given to treat the symptoms of the disorder. The most popular form of treatment is medication. Psychotherapy (mental health treatment) and lifestyle modifications are also effective.
